What knitwear is worth

What lifts the price

  • Natural fibres with real weight
  • No moth damage or thinning

What pulls it down

  • Felting and shrinkage from hot washing
  • Stretched necklines

Working out what yours is worth

  • Hold the garment up to the light to reveal holes
  • Lay it flat and measure chest, length and sleeve

Getting it ready

  • Sort by fibre: put anything wool, cashmere or merino aside from the acrylic.
  • De-pill everything and check each piece against a window for moth holes.

Photograph

  • The composition labels grouped together
  • The best two or three pieces individually

Put in the description

  • Fibre composition of each piece
  • Any recognisable brands included

Fibre, count and size: “Wool Knitwear Bundle, 5 Pieces, Size M, All Natural Fibre”. Saying all natural fibre is a genuine differentiator in a bundle listing. Keep bundles to a single size — mixed sizes are much less useful to any one buyer.
